✦ Synopsis


Abstract

magnified image

A novel synthetic route to 2‐methyl‐1,8‐dioxa‐dibenzo[e,h]azulenes [1] via cyclisation of the corresponding 1,4‐dicarbonyl compound is described. 1,4‐Dicarbonyl compounds were synthesized by the alkylation reaction of the 11__H__‐dibenzo[b,f]oxepine‐10‐one while analogous alkylation of 11__H__‐dibenzo[b,f]thiepine‐10‐one resulted in formation of O‐alkylated products. Selective oxidation of 2‐methyl group afforded 1,8‐dioxa‐dibenzo[e,h]azulenes with formyl and hydroxymethyl functionality at C(2) position.
